Hours after Paris Hilton was sent home under house arrest Thursday the judge who originally put her in jail on a reckless driving probation violation ordered her back to court to determine whether he should return her to jail.
Superior Court Judge Michael T. Sauer issued his order after the city attorney filed a petition late Thursday afternoon demanding to show cause why Sheriff Lee Baca should not be held in contempt of court for releasing Hilton Thursday morning and demanding that Hilton be held in custody.
Hilton was ordered to report to court at 9 a.m., Superior Court spokesman Allan Parachini told the Associated Press.
"My understanding is she will be brought in in a sheriff's vehicle from her home," Parachini said, adding that although Hilton is at home she is technically in custody because she is under house arrest.
